Mayberry' August 2013The United States Air Force (USAF) trains C-130H Loadmaster students at Little Rock Air Force Base (AFB) through a civilian contract. The Aircrew Training System (ATS) contractor utilizes a Fuselage Toward the Implementation of Augmented Reality TrainingTrainer (FuT) to provide scenarios for the Loadmaster students to practice loading and unloading a simulated aircraft.
